Output ac79a3c519b324be74334c56f9dbd77c9d7724c84d0b530f87c8372010239108:0

value
22697060
script pubkey
OP_0 OP_PUSHBYTES_20 269a88381eb0d8cb138dc46ebccd4b1bd79f79ab
address
ltc1qy6dgswq7krvvkyudc3hten2tr0te77dtkw9dv4
transaction
ac79a3c519b324be74334c56f9dbd77c9d7724c84d0b530f87c8372010239108
spent
true